Pipalyajagir in context
With 469 people at the 2011 Census, Pipalyajagir was the 389th most populous of its district's 798 villages, below the district average of 728.
Literacy stood at 59.90%, 5.9 points below the district's rural average of 65.78%.
The sex ratio was 891 women per 1,000 men (78 below the district's rural figure of 969).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 1073, 150 above the rural national 923.
65.9% of the population were recorded as workers, 10.3 points above the district's rural rate.
